Victor John Berens, age 91, of Quinter, KS died Thursday, February 18, 2010 at Gove County Medical Center following a short illness. He was born July 28, 1918 to Ulrich and Elizabeth (Von Lintel) Berens in Vincent, KS.
On May 3, 1949, he married Irene Mermis at St. Ann's Catholic Church in Walker, KS. After their marriage, they moved to a farm north of Park. To this union, four children were born: Wayne, Leon, LeAnn and Eileen. Irene preceded him in death on October 2, 2007.
He was a member of the Sacred Heart Catholic Church in Park and a member of the Knights of Columbus. He was a World War II veteran having served in Australia, New Guinea and the Philippine Islands. After moving to Quinter from Park, he was an active volunteer at the Long Term Care facility where you could find him calling the numbers for Bingo and playing cards with the residents. For years, he served as the Lector for the Monday morning Masses held at the Long Term Care facility.
Victor enjoyed gardening and often took over the cooking for family dinners. He loved spending time with his grandchildren and a favorite activity was giving them piggy-back rides when they were little. He also enjoyed a good game of checkers, teaching many of them how to play.
